What's Happening?
The Jacksonville Jaguars have updated their Week 18 injury report with the return of right tackle Anton Harrison to full practice. Harrison, who was previously a non-participant due to illness, resumed practice on Thursday. The rest of the injury report remains unchanged, with several players like Ezra Cleveland, Robert Hainsey, and Greg Newsome listed as limited participants. Patrick Mekari continues to be sidelined with a back injury sustained in Week 16. The Jaguars are preparing for their upcoming game against the Tennessee Titans, where they will don their Prowler throwback uniforms.
